SAN FRANCISCO – May 17, 2007 – Today Ubisoft, one of the world's largest video game publishers, announced that resident evil® 4 for the PC has shipped to retailers nationwide. Widely recognized as the Game of the Year of 2005, resident evil 4 is the latest installment in Capcom's critically acclaimed survival horror franchise, resident evil. The game has an ESRB rating of "M†for Mature and an MSRP of $19.99.

About resident evil 4:
The game brings players to a mysterious location in Europe as U.S. agent Leon Kennedy looks into the abduction of the president's daughter. Encountering unimaginable horrors, he must find out what is behind the terror.
• New chapters – play as Ada Wong in "Separate Ways,†five terrifying, adrenaline-pumping missions that reveal additional horrific surprises
• New weapons, including the P.R.L.412 laser cannon and the Gunpowder Bowgun
• New unlockable costumes for Leon and Ashley
• Unsurpassed visuals with breathtaking 3D graphics and effects
• Fast-paced, edge-of-your-seat action
• New gameplay mechanics – behind-the-back camera perspective and hit zone aiming system.

About Capcom:
Capcom is a leading worldwide developer, publisher and distributor of interactive entertainment. Founded in 1983, the company has created world renowned franchises including Resident Evil, Street Fighter, Mega Man, Viewtiful Joe, Devil May Cry and the Onimusha series. Headquartered in Osaka, Japan, the company maintains operations in the U.S., United Kingdom, Germany, Tokyo and Hong Kong.
